Output 16193a6d6dcd07ad15bf4484c677827b76bed4105503fe7ea0450f91b89f6b87: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e67d5aa434bffb035f60d54b4a6b79db719dea OP_EQUAL
address
3CSR6h1FfxsKc123En2AaWZaHSQ6ApS74B
transaction
16193a6d6dcd07ad15bf4484c677827b76bed4105503fe7ea0450f91b89f6b87
spent
true